Well, I was loading a page in safari and then EVERYTHING stoped working. I can't shut it off, battery won't say if it's charging or not, volume keys don't work. I've tried syncing it to try a restore but it won't even sync either. I've also tried holding the home button for a few seconds to force quit safari but no luck.

What should I do?

You may have already done this but have you done a soft reset on it yet.

You do this by holding the sleep/wake button down while pressing the home button until you see the apple symbol in the middle of the screen.
